Name of deceased: Violet Irene Fiscus (nee Swensen)

Aged: 96 yrs, 10 mo, 13 days

Residence: Harlan, Shelby County, IA

Born: Oct. 6, 1921; rural Harlan, Shelby County, IA

Died: Aug. 19, 2018; Elm Crest Retirement Community, Harlan, Shelby County, IA

Funeral services: Saturday, Aug. 25, 2018; United Methodist Church, Kirkman, IA; burial was in Rose Hill Cemetery,
Kirkman, IA

Survived by: Son, Terry Fiscus of Kirkman, IA; grandchildren, Lyn & Troy Ahrenholtz of Defiance, IA, Shilo & Jeff Bladt of Harlan, IA, Dustin & Angie Fiscus of Blue Springs, MO, Jeremy & Amy Fiscus of Fremont, NE, and Seth Fiscus of Harlan, IA; great-grandchildren, Emma Ahrenholtz, Anna Ahrenholtz, Hannah Bladt, Isaiah Ahrenholtz, Dalton Fiscus, Samuel Bladt, Eli Fiscus, Mya Fiscus, and Maira Fiscus; daughter-in-law, Joleen Fiscus of Harlan, IA; siblings, Donald & Joann Swensen of Bellevue, NE, and Joy & Tom Salmon of Colorado Springs, CO; nieces; nephews; other family members and friends

Predeceased by: Parents, Nels Christian and Johanna (nee Jensen) Swensen; husband, Wayne Fiscus; son, Kelly Fiscus; daughter-in-law, Carolyn Fiscus; siblings, Ina Caroll, Ethel Dent, Norman Swensen, Dagny Svendsen, Christena Johnson, and Mae Heilig

Education: Attended country schools around the Harlan (IA) area through grade school

Religious affiliation: long-time member of the United Methodist Church, Kirkman, IA and the United Methodist Women's group

Military service: n/a

Marriage: Wayne Fiscus; Dec. 21, 1943; location not provided

Employment: After graduating from grade school, Violet worked for families cleaning their homes, caring for the sick, elderly, and newborn babies as a live-in nanny. After her marriage, she remained at home to raise their sons, care for their homestead and worked with Wayne on the farm.

Hobbies/Interests: enjoyed watching local racing and NASCAR, antique auctions and attending their grandchildren's and great-grandchildren's school and sports activities. She loved cooking and baking. Although she was never formally taught to play the piano, Violet could play by ear. She also was an avid cake decorator and proud of her Danish heritage.
